Date: Mon, 24 Feb 2020 21:47:39 +0000 From: bugzilla-noreply@freebsd.org To: ports-bugs@FreeBSD.org Subject: [Bug 244382] www/wordpress: add php72-json as a dependency Message-ID: <bug-244382-7788@https.bugs.freebsd.org/bugzilla/>
next in thread | raw e-mail | index | archive | help
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=3D244382 Bug ID: 244382 Summary: www/wordpress: add php72-json as a dependency Product: Ports & Packages Version: Latest Hardware: Any OS: Any Status: New Severity: Affects Many People Priority: --- Component: Individual Port(s) Assignee: joneum@FreeBSD.org Reporter: freebsd.org@neant.ro Flags: maintainer-feedback?(joneum@FreeBSD.org) Assignee: joneum@FreeBSD.org Without php-json extension Wordpress 5.3.2 fails during a fresh install with the following in Nginx error log: [error] 9437#100173: *5 FastCGI sent in stderr: "PHP message: PHP Fatal err= or:=20 Uncaught Error: Call to undefined function json_decode() in /usr/local/www/wordpress/wp-includes/class-wp-block-parser.php:232 Stack trace: #0 /usr/local/www/wordpress/wp-includes/blocks.php(521): WP_Block_Parser->parse('email@address.spam') #1 /usr/local/www/wordpress/wp-includes/blocks.php(274): parse_blocks('email@address.spam') (...) Also, with php72-json installed it suggests a password during install and w= arns against weak passwords. Without php72-json it just asked for the password twice. There are probably more differences later. This post has more details: https://make.wordpress.org/core/2019/10/15/php-native-json-extension-now-re= quired/ --=20 You are receiving this mail because: You are the assignee for the bug.=
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?bug-244382-7788>